Squid Game, a dystopian South Korean drama, has become Netflix’s most successful series launch ever, with 111 million viewers since its debut less than four weeks ago, according to the streaming site.
In this macabre universe, marginalized people are pitted against one another in traditional children’s games, according to the unprecedented global viral success.
While the winner can walk away with millions of dollars, losers are killed.
Netflix tweeted, “Squid Game has officially reached 111 million fans — making it our biggest series launch ever!”
